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"build respect"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when discussing the process of fostering or developing respect in relationships, teams, or communities. Example: "To create a positive work environment, it's essential to build respect among team members."

Linguistic Context
The phrase "build respect" functions as a verb phrase where "build" is the transitive verb and "respect" is the direct object. It expresses the action of creating or developing respect. Ludwig AI confirms its grammatical correctness and usability.

More alternative expressions(6)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
foster respect
Emphasizes nurturing and promoting respect over time.
cultivate respect
Similar to foster, suggesting a deliberate and careful effort to grow respect.
earn respect
Focuses on gaining respect through actions and achievements.
gain respect
A more general term for acquiring respect, without specifying how.
command respect
Implies a position of authority that naturally attracts respect.
win respect
Suggests overcoming obstacles to achieve respect.
establish respect
Focuses on setting up a foundation of respect.
develop respect
Highlights the gradual process of respect formation.
grow respect
Emphasizes the natural increase of respect over time.
encourage respect
Suggests actively promoting respect among individuals.
FAQs
How can I "build respect" in a professional setting?
You can "build respect" in a professional setting by demonstrating competence, maintaining ethical standards, and valuing the contributions of your colleagues. Effective communication and active listening are also crucial.
What are some alternatives to the phrase "build respect"?
You can use alternatives like "foster respect", "cultivate respect", or "earn respect" depending on the specific context and nuance you want to convey.
Is it better to "build respect" or "demand respect"?
"Building respect" is generally more effective and sustainable than "demanding respect". Demanding respect often leads to resentment, while building it through positive actions fosters genuine regard.
How does showing vulnerability help "build respect"?
Showing vulnerability, when appropriate, can humanize you and make you more relatable. This can "build respect" by demonstrating authenticity and trust, encouraging others to reciprocate.
